Managed Reporting
This archive includes topics related to managed reporting. With a managed reporting approach, technical report developers in the IT department gather requirements from and deliver this information to business personnel across the organization.

Dashboards have become a standard requirement of corporate users’ BI initiatives. This is due to the ease of use, and the convenient, fast access to critical data that they provide. Interactive dashboards let executives, managers and analysts monitor, measure and share key performance metrics instantly and view the information most pertinent to their roles. Read More...
